Conditions are favourable everywhere for growing vines. The climate is a perfect blend of oceanic and Mediterranean influences. Gaillac is also swept by the beneficial Autan wind, a drying wind that ensures extraordinarily healthy harvests for the winegrowers.
Recognised as an AOC since 1938, the Gaillac vineyards are a bastion of ancient grape varieties. While winegrowers everywhere like to rediscover the old grape varieties that have sometimes been left aside, our vineyards are among those that have never broken with their history. Our grape varieties are our identity. Mauzac, Loin de l'œil and Ondenc for the whites, Braucol, Duras and Prunelart for the reds.
The range of our wines is dazzling in its profiles and tastes, including fresh whites, reds and rosés, still and sparkling wines, dry and sweet wines, all united by the same grape varieties.
